Making CCB's very important ChemGrades DB more robust, and enabling necessary increased functionality, especially for teaching faculty and students. Ensuring its long-term support and operation. Representing customer is Pat Hine's (PatH).
Links
When completed, here's the URL for the read-only web access:
Eval from 8/13/13:
To do's and questions
Establish procedure for PatH to update web-hosted data. "Push the button".
As of 8/16/13, function doesn't exist for PatH.
- Requires ODBC connection. Not possible at FMPro server; must be set up at FMPro client's computer.
- Do for PatH's computer. As backup, do on Sam's computer.
- Current plan: For each computer, set ODBC up as system's Admin (vs. user) so ODBC accessible/ configured for any computer account.
- Tu will work with Roger.
- Tu needs IP addresses. Roger can do the installs. And he may have better alternatives. :-)
Establish semester-start procedures and processes. Includes:
- Initially populating the DB with PeopleSoft data via a PeopleSoft import.
- Question: Can a vetted clone of a DB on Pat's desktop be used to replace the server production DB?
- Function tends to be of most value at the beginning of the semester. Other times? (See revert procedure, below).
Notes:
- This is a one-time import per DB.
- ChemIT can do the uploads, if not A&S (if at all desired).
Establish semester-end procedures and processes. Includes:
- Pat pulling the final data
- The data getting zeroed out in each of the ChemGrades DBs before the start of their next use
Establish DB revert procedure. Initiating request and subsequent restoration from back-up.
- Likelihood of needing to do this is reduced because Pat and others can run recent clone of production DB (from backup) and test on own desktop first.
Ensure Pat's "low friction" access to the backup files.
- Do in a way to minimize need for mediation by others. Pat may need access during a weekend or after-hours, for example.
- Confirm Pat's access.
Enable Pat's view of DB data from home.
- View only (where web access or clone (backup) would suffice), or are modifications required?
- Web version OK for view-only of some data, but obviously not as flexible for searching.
- Idea 1: With FMPro installed on dept. laptop, access AS's FMPro server off-campus (possible?) and do the work that way.
- Idea 2: Enable Remote Desktop on PatH's main work computer. Access from off-campus via VPN.
Ensure security of FERPA data in Grades DB.
See Michael Hint's emails with Tu and Frank for more on this. Some thoughts, initially:
- FERPA-like data so ChemIT would appreciate understanding the ACL (see for subnet?) and firewall configurations.
- ChemIT thinks there shouldn't be any off-campus access except via VPN. Thus take off of public net and put into 10-space. But there may be other factors to consider.
- Who else has access to Grades DB FMPro DB?
- Ideal: Make all access via NetID/ NetID p/w, not via FMPro DB's own controls.
- Control NetID membership via Active Directory groups.
- Start with Grad TA access, via theTA room kiosks? Also start with faculty access?
- Once process confirmed, establish procedure for enabling and disabling NetID access to Grades FMPro DB by grads and faculty
- Can take ChemIT staff less than a minute to do this, and is effective immediately.
- Control NetID membership via Active Directory groups.
- Confirm FMPro server and admin groups support required staff access rights.
- Currently it authorized CCB staff to see all PatH sees.
- Confirm Becky can see what she needs to see.
- Exports data using PatH's account.
- Confirm TAs can see/ edit what they need to edit.
Clarify support and maintenance expectations
- Clarify to what degree A&S staff (Dani and Tu) are available and willing to perform support.
- Hosting vs. Design/ Creation vs. Support
- Distinguish between something breaking (worked yesterday!) and new need (consultation/ design/ implementation).
Map out transition steps remaining
- Change direction of cname, <grades.chem.cornell.edu> from old to new instance.
- ChemIT needs a date.
- Doing this means other systems (2 computers in TA room; Becky's computer) automatically cut-over. :-)
- Shut off access to old ChemIT-run instance (Win7 VM). "Legacy Grades".
- ChemIT needs a date.
- When add access via AD groups?